Crusaders sweeps Walla Walla for sixth straight victory

| By:
COLLEGE PLACE, Wash. - Becky Flores had seven kills to lead the Northwest Nazarene volleyball team to a 25-11, 25-10, 25-10 non-conference victory over Walla Walla University on Friday afternoon in College Place.

The Crusaders, now 13-5 overall, increased their winning streak to five and will look to make it six-in-a-row tomorrow night when they return to league play at Central Washington University.

Reisa Fessler and Jordan Glorfield each had five kills and Glorfield led the Crusaders with seven digs as NNU hit .694 in the match, including a .813 clip in the third set.

Michelle Terpstra had 11 assists and Briana Classen had 10 as the Crusader attack had 34 kills on 31 assists.
